How to Get a CIBC Bank Statement (PDF & CSV)

How to Get a CIBC Bank Statement (PDF & CSV, 2026)
Quick answer

Log in to CIBC Online Banking at cibc.com or the CIBC Mobile Banking app → select the account → View eStatements → pick the month → Download PDF. For CSV use "Account Activity" → Download. 7 years online. Not password-protected.

CIBC Online Banking

  1. 1Go to cibc.com and click Sign On
  2. 2Enter your client card number and password
  3. 3Click the account — chequing, savings, credit card, line of credit, or mortgage
  4. 4Click "View eStatements"
  5. 5Pick a statement period (up to 7 years)
  6. 6Click Download PDF
Simplii Financial customer? Simplii is CIBC's digital brand but uses a separate portal. Log in at simplii.com instead of cibc.com to access Simplii statements. Same flow — statement menu, date range, Download PDF.
